Water vapour in the atmosphere can result in cloud development and the formation of precipitation. Water vapour comes from evaporation from the ocean. All weather (i. e. clouds and precipitation) is confined to the troposphere. The ozone layer (25 km above the surface) protects us from the suns harmful uv rays; it is found in the stratosphere. Cloud names generally contain a prefix and a suffix. The prefix describes the height of the cloud; the suffix describes its appearance. Ex: a high puffy cloud is called a cirrocumulus cloud.
